How to Submit Funds

The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society utilizes Paycor, an accounting center based in Cincinnati, Ohio, to process all Team In Training contributions. In your TNT Folder is the Participant Donor Form, which you will complete and submit to the Accounting Center with your donations. Mailing labels have also been provided for your use.

Page one of the Participant Donor Form is a summary page that identifies you, your chapter, the event you are participating in, and gives a total of the donations enclosed.

  • Page two of the Donation Processing Form is the Credit Card Donation section to list all information for credit card donations.
  • Page three of the Donation Processing Form is the Cash Donation section used to record donor information for cash contributions that have been converted into your personal check and/or for listing donor information that is not provided on a check (i.e., no address, or change of address).

Instruct your contributors to forward all mailed donations directly to you. Do not have your contributors send donations directly to the Accounting Center P.O. Box. (Those donations made via your Active.com personal web page are processed directly – no need for you to complete a form or mail anything!)

In order to effectively process your contributions and to ensure accurate and timely postings to your account, it is important that you closely follow the instructions outlined below.

Thank yous and Receipts for Donors
If you supply us with your donors’ names and addresses (on checks, Cash Donation Forms or Credit Card Donation Forms), The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society sends thank you letters to all donors. Donors who contribute via your online fundraising page will receive a thank you from the Society via e-mail, rather than via postal mail. These acknowledgments, in addition to the donors’ canceled checks or credit card statements, serve as receipts. We do, however, highly recommend that you, personally, acknowledge all contributions you received in your fundraising efforts as well.

Please note: The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society does not sell or share our mailing lists. Your donor’s name will be in our database so they may be thanked for their donation and they might receive future correspondence about the Society or the Team In Training program. If your donor does not want to receive additional mailings from The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society, please block out their address on their check or do not include it on the cash donation form. However, this also means they will not receive a thank you from The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society.

Handling Contributions

1. Send in your contributions early and consistently— do not wait to turn them in! Credit cards and checks expire, so you want to send them to Paycor as quickly as possible. We recommend mailing donations in weekly. Gather all the funds you have received for that week and group them according to type of contribution, i.e. check, cash, credit card or matching gift and process as follows:

Cash Contributions
DO NOT SEND CASH! Convert cash contributions and any foreign currency into a check or money order (payable to The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society). Complete the Cash Donation section of the Participant Donor Form for all cash contributions to ensure proper acknowledgment of gift and so they may receive a receipt for tax purposes. The Paycor Accounting Center will not be liable for any lost or stolen cash donations.

Foreign Currency
Foreign Currency by definition means any check that is drawn off of a NON-U.S. bank, OR does not have „U.S. dollars” imprinted on the check. („U.S. dollars” may not be hand written on the check.) The participant must convert this type of donation into U.S. dollars. Deposit the donation into your personal account and write a check for the amount of the U.S. currency and forward it to the Accounting Center with the completed Cash Donation section of the Participant Donor Form to ensure proper acknowledgement of the donation. (Note: Donors outside the U.S. may find it easier to make a contribution by credit card, which will be charged in U.S. dollars.)

Check Contributions
Write your name, team, sport and „Silicon Valley Monterey Bay Area Chapter” in the memo section of each check, then simply batch and enclose. [Note: If there is no name and/or address on the check, use the Cash Donation section of the Participant Donor Form to identify name and address of the donor to ensure proper acknowledgment of the gift and so they may receive a receipt for tax purposes.]

  • DO NOT STAPLE OR TAPE CHECKS TO DONOR FORMS.
  • DO NOT SEND POSTDATED CHECKS- hold these in your possession until the check date is valid.
  • DO NOT SEND CHECKS DATED OVER 3 MONTHS OLD-these checks will not be accepted and will be returned. It is important to send in your donations in a timely manner.
  • Please review checks to ensure they are signed and dated.

Credit Card Contributions
Complete the Credit Card Donation section of the Participant Donor Form for all credit card contributions. Be very careful to be accurate and complete when copying the credit card information (account number, expiration date, $ amount), as errors will result in denied approval. The Accounting Center can only process Visa, MasterCard, and American Express.

Forwarding Contributions to the Accounting Center

Accumulate your contributions, complete the Participant Donor Form as outlined above, make a photocopy of everything you will submit, and send in donations weekly to the Accounting Center. A set of labels to the Accounting Center in Cincinnati, Ohio (address below) is included in the front pocket of your TNT folder for your convenience. Be sure to use sufficient postage.

Please Note: DO NOT SEND YOUR DONATIONS VIA UPS or FEDEX - they will not deliver to a Post Office Box address. You may use Express Mail or Certified Mail through the Post Office.

You must allow 10-14 business days from the time you mail in your donations for them to be posted to your account.
  • Keep a log of all of your donations received as well as copies of everything that you mail in.
  • VERY IMPORTANT: To ensure timeliness and accuracy, please use only the Participant Donor Form attached to submit your donations to the Accounting Center. Do not send any sponsor forms, donor cards, donor letters, etc., to the Accounting Center. These items are not necessary, slow down processing and add to your mailing costs.
